Materials Used in Building Piraminds

The primary materials used in the construction of piraminds include limestone, granite, and basalt. Limestone was extensively used due to its availability and ease of shaping. The interior core of piramids typically consisted of rough-cut blocks, while the outer surface was often polished to create a gleaming façade.

The use of granite, particularly for burial chambers and inner sanctums, signifies the high status of the individuals interred within. This not only symbolized wealth and power but also showcased the technological advancement of the era, allowing for the transport of massive stones over distance.

Labor and Workforce Management

Constructing a pyramid required a large workforce. Contrary to popular belief, many historians argue that these laborers were not slaves but rather skilled workers who were likely compensated for their labor. Strong evidence points towards a system of labor organization, where workers were arranged into teams, each responsible for different aspects of construction—from quarrying stones to the final sealing of burial chambers.

This workforce management reflected a societal structure capable of supporting complex projects, indicating a well-organized state. Seasonal flooding of the Nile allowed farmers to assume these roles, showcasing a dynamic interaction between agriculture and monumental construction.

Theories Surrounding Construction Methods

Multiple theories exist surrounding the actual construction methods employed to build piraminds. One popular theory suggests that ramps were used, constructed to allow workers to haul massive stone blocks to higher elevations. These ramps would vary in design—some proposed a straight approach, while others indicate a zig-zag or circular formation to facilitate movement without exhausting the workforce.

Other theories speculate on the use of levers and counterweights, which would have made vertical lifting achievable with less effort. Understanding these methods sheds light on the innovative spirit prevalent in ancient societies and their desire to leave a lasting mark on the world.
